Based on: Scenario 1 Upload an antigen test with a photo. Our national health service has decided to create a portal that will allow citizens to report a positive antigen test for COVID-19 and to list their close contacts online. Citizens who have symptoms of the virus or are a close contact of a confirmed case can use store-bought test kits and upload any positive results to the portal. The system will require citizens to create an account with a username and password, to provide personal information including full name, address, date of birth and phone number, and to upload an image of a positive antigen test. They can also provide a list of close contacts, including their full names and phone numbers.

The Database(s) structure SQL is stored in the database folder in the main branch. The link to my video demonstration is in my Video-Demo folder. The encryption functions are stored in the cryptography.inc.php file in the includes folder.
Encryption algorithim used was AES-256-CTR The IVs are generated using random_bytes to generate cryptographically secure random bytes.
Encryption functions are used in the following pages:
Encryption: upload.inc.php update.inc.php signup.inc.php ccUpload.inc.php
Decryption: signup.php upload.php manageDetails.php
